Growth Drivers: Micron offers both DRAM and NAND products. While DRAM chips are key components in PCs, NAND flash chips are crucial for portable electronic devices.

Improving prices for DRAM and NAND chips make us confident about Micron’s growth. Per various sources, the prices for these specific chips have improved primarily due to a better product mix optimization and higher-than-expected demand for PCs, servers and mobiles.

Mergers and acquisitions are actively expanding Micron's core business. Notably, the company acquired the remaining stake in Inotera in December and made the brand a wholly owned subsidiary in Taiwan.

It is worth mentioning that Inotera will have some operational benefits, leading to efficient management of investment levels and cadence, followed by alignment with global manufacturing operations.

Going forward, the acquisitions of Elpida and Rexchip (now known as Micron Memory Japan, Inc. and Micron Memory Taiwan Co., Ltd., respectively) will increase Micron’s traction in the memory market.

Micron is positive about the product launches and growing demand, particularly that of SSD products. We also believe that any increase in prices will have a favorable impact on the company’s overall results. We anticipate these benefits to be a tailwind for the company, going forward.
